Dyrk1a is required for craniofacial development in Xenopus laevis

Summary

Loss of function in DYRK1A causes craniofacial defects. This study in Xenopus revealed DYRK1A deficiency leads to malformations by affecting cell proliferation and death, offering insights into human birth defects.
